GLYCIPHAGE SR 500 MG

Indications

GLYCIPHAGE SR 500 MG is primarily indicated for the management of type 2 diabetes mellitus. It is used as an adjunct to diet and exercise to improve glycemic control in adults. This medication is particularly beneficial for patients who are overweight and have insulin resistance. GLYCIPHAGE SR is often prescribed when dietary measures and physical activity alone are insufficient to achieve adequate glycemic control.

Mechanism of Action

The active ingredient in GLYCIPHAGE SR is Metformin hydrochloride, which belongs to the biguanide class of oral hypoglycemic agents. Metformin works primarily by reducing hepatic glucose production, particularly by decreasing gluconeogenesis in the liver. It also enhances insulin sensitivity in peripheral tissues, thereby improving glucose uptake and utilization. Additionally, Metformin slows intestinal absorption of glucose, which contributes to its overall effect on blood sugar levels. This multifaceted approach helps to lower blood glucose levels without causing significant hypoglycemia.

Pharmacological Properties

Metformin is characterized by its favorable pharmacokinetic profile. After oral administration, it is absorbed from the gastrointestinal tract, with peak plasma concentrations typically reached within 2-3 hours. The bioavailability of Metformin is approximately 50-60% when taken with food. It is not metabolized in the liver, which distinguishes it from many other antidiabetic medications. Instead, it is excreted unchanged in the urine. The elimination half-life of Metformin is approximately 6 hours, allowing for its once or twice daily dosing regimen. GLYCIPHAGE SR is formulated as a sustained-release tablet, which provides a gradual release of Metformin, thereby enhancing patient compliance and minimizing gastrointestinal side effects.

Contraindications

GLYCIPHAGE SR is contraindicated in several situations. It should not be used in patients with known hypersensitivity to Metformin or any of its components. Additionally, it is contraindicated in individuals with renal impairment, specifically those with an estimated glomerular filtration rate (eGFR) below 30 mL/min, as this increases the risk of lactic acidosis. Other contraindications include acute or chronic metabolic acidosis, including diabetic ketoacidosis, and conditions that may lead to tissue hypoxia, such as severe cardiovascular or respiratory failure. Patients undergoing radiologic studies involving iodinated contrast media should also discontinue Metformin temporarily due to the risk of renal impairment.

Side Effects

The use of GLYCIPHAGE SR may be associated with several side effects. The most common adverse effects include gastrointestinal disturbances such as nausea, vomiting, diarrhea, abdominal discomfort, and flatulence. These symptoms are often transient and may resolve with continued use or dose adjustment. A rare but serious side effect is lactic acidosis, a condition characterized by the accumulation of lactic acid in the bloodstream, which can be life-threatening. Symptoms of lactic acidosis include muscle pain, difficulty breathing, abdominal pain, and unusual fatigue. Patients should be educated on the signs and symptoms of this condition and advised to seek immediate medical attention if they occur. Other less common side effects may include vitamin B12 deficiency, which can occur with long-term use.

Dosage and Administration

The recommended starting dose of GLYCIPHAGE SR for adults is typically 500 mg once daily, taken with the evening meal to reduce gastrointestinal side effects. Depending on the patient’s glycemic response and tolerance, the dosage may be gradually increased to a maximum of 2000 mg per day, divided into two doses. It is essential to monitor renal function regularly, especially in older adults or those with preexisting renal conditions. For patients switching from other antidiabetic medications, appropriate adjustments should be made based on the patient’s current treatment regimen and blood glucose levels. Patients should be instructed to take GLYCIPHAGE SR with food to minimize gastrointestinal discomfort and enhance absorption.

Interactions

GLYCIPHAGE SR may interact with several medications, which can affect its efficacy or increase the risk of adverse effects. Concomitant use of diuretics, corticosteroids, or other medications that may affect renal function can increase the risk of lactic acidosis. Additionally, the use of alcohol should be limited, as it can potentiate the effects of Metformin on lactate metabolism. Certain medications, such as cationic drugs that are eliminated by renal tubular secretion, may also interact with Metformin, leading to increased plasma concentrations. It is crucial for healthcare providers to review a patient’s complete medication list to identify potential interactions before initiating treatment with GLYCIPHAGE SR.

Precautions

Before initiating therapy with GLYCIPHAGE SR, a thorough medical history and physical examination should be conducted. Special precautions should be taken in patients with a history of renal impairment, liver disease, or heart failure. Regular monitoring of renal function is essential, particularly in older adults and those with risk factors for renal impairment. Patients should be advised to maintain adequate hydration and to report any signs of lactic acidosis promptly. Additionally, it is important to counsel patients on the importance of adhering to prescribed dietary and lifestyle modifications in conjunction with medication therapy to achieve optimal glycemic control.

Clinical Studies

Numerous clinical studies have demonstrated the efficacy and safety of GLYCIPHAGE SR in managing type 2 diabetes. In randomized controlled trials, Metformin has been shown to significantly reduce HbA1c levels, improve fasting and postprandial glucose levels, and contribute to weight loss in overweight patients. Long-term studies have also indicated that Metformin may have cardiovascular benefits, reducing the risk of cardiovascular events in patients with type 2 diabetes. Additionally, studies have highlighted the favorable safety profile of Metformin, with a low incidence of hypoglycemia compared to other antidiabetic agents. These findings support the use of GLYCIPHAGE SR as a first-line therapy in the management of type 2 diabetes.
